Overview

The Implementing and Operating Cisco Data Center Core Technologies (DCCOR) course prepares learners for the Cisco CCNP Data Center and CCIE Data Center certifications, equipping them with the skills required for advanced data center roles. Participants will develop expertise in implementing data center compute, LAN, and SAN infrastructure, as well as essential automation and security concepts.

The course provides hands-on experience in deploying, securing, operating, and maintaining Cisco data center infrastructure, including Cisco MDS Switches, Cisco Nexus Switches, Cisco Unified Computing System (UCS) B-Series Blade Servers, and UCS C-Series Rack Servers.

This course includes five instructor-led training days and three self-study days, allowing learners to reinforce their understanding through additional materials.

It prepares learners for the 350-601 Implementing Cisco Data Center Core Technologies (DCCOR) exam and earns them 64 Continuing Education (CE) credits towards recertification.

Prerequisites

To fully benefit from this course, learners should have:

  • Familiarity with Ethernet and TCP/IP networking
  • Understanding of storage area networks (SANs)
  • Knowledge of Fibre Channel protocol
  • Ability to identify Cisco Nexus and Cisco MDS products
  • Understanding of Cisco Enterprise Data Center architecture
  • Knowledge of server system design and architecture
  • Familiarity with hypervisor technologies such as VMware

Delegates will learn how to

Upon completing this course, learners will be able to:

  • Implement routing and switching protocols in data center environments
  • Deploy overlay networks within a data center
  • Introduce Cisco Application Centric Infrastructure (ACI) concepts and Virtual Machine Manager (VMM) domain integration
  • Describe Cisco Cloud Services and deployment models
  • Implement Fibre Channel fabric and Fibre Channel over Ethernet (FCoE) unified fabric
  • Implement security features in data centers
  • Manage software and monitor infrastructure performance
  • Configure Cisco UCS Fabric Interconnect and server abstraction
  • Establish SAN connectivity for Cisco UCS environments
  • Explain Cisco HyperFlex infrastructure concepts and benefits
  • Implement automation and scripting tools in a data center environment
  • Evaluate automation and orchestration technologies

Exams and assessments

This course prepares learners for the 350-601 DCCOR exam, which validates expertise in implementing core data center technologies, including network, compute, storage network, automation, and security.

Upon passing the exam, learners earn the Cisco Certified Specialist - Data Center Core certification and satisfy the core requirement for the following certifications:

  • CCNP Data Center
  • CCIE Data Center
